BlackBerry 8000 series
January 5th, 2008
Looks like the BlackBerry 8000 series has a brand new addition to the family, although the model number has not been decided upon just yet. Nevertheless, I’m sure you are more interested in what lies beneath the hood. This Vodafone offering will be launched this May and comes with a 624Mz processor, a Tavor chipset, full HSDPA with tri-band UMTS (850/1900/2100) connectivity, a “half VGA” display (480 x 320), a 1500mAh battery, GPS navigation function, WiFi support and a 2 megapixel camera. Best bring a universal charger with you wherever you go since this BlackBerry 8xxx device sounds as if it loves guzzling up juice like there’s no tomorrow.
